Drama as man confronts wife after being caught with another man

A dramatic confrontation between a husband and his wife has taken social media by storm after the man allegedly caught her with another man in a suggestive position.
In the viral video, the enraged husband stormed a shop, where he found his wife seated closely with another man, engaging in what appeared to be an intimate conversation. Unable to contain his anger, he immediately began filming them, shaming his wife and accusing her of infidelity.
However, the woman defended herself, stating that she had already informed him that she was no longer interested in their relationship. The husband, refusing to accept her claim, reminded her that they have a son together and that their recent disagreement was nothing more than a minor quarrel.
The man who was caught with the woman also spoke in his defense, claiming that she never disclosed to him that she was married.
The video has since sent the social media abuzz with mixed reactions online, as social media users debating the actions of all parties involved.
